Martin van Bruinessen
Martin van Bruinessen (born July 10, 1946 in Schoonhoven ) is a Dutch sociologist .
He studied physics, mathematics (graduation 1971) and then anthropology and sociology at the University of Utrecht . Between 1974 and 1976 he conducted many field surveys among the Kurds in Iraq , Iran and Turkey . In 1978 he submitted his dissertation Agha, Shaikh and State. On the Social and Political Organization of Kurdistan presented his most important work to date. This soon became a standard work of comparative social research, although it had not appeared in bookshops until the German translation of its revised version in 1989. Van Bruinessen describes the social-religious structures of the Kurds.
In 1977 van Bruinessen began research on Ottoman history at the University of Utrecht . In 1988 the work Evliya Çelebi was published in Diyarbekir . From 1978 to 1981 he traveled very often to Iran, Turkey and Afghanistan . In addition to the Kurds and Turkey, from 1982 onwards he also dealt a lot with Indonesia , where he stayed for six years. There he taught sociology at the University of Yogyakarta .
From 1994 van Bruinessen taught Kurdish and Turkish at the University of Utrecht. From 1996 to 1997 he was visiting professor for Kurdish studies at the Free University of Berlin .
Fonts (selection)
Monographs
- with Hendrik Boeschoten : Evliya Çelebi in Diyarbekir: The Relevant Section of the Seyahatname edited with translation, commentary and introduction (= Evliya Çelebi's: Land and people of the Ottoman Empire in the seventeenth century. A corpus of partial editions, Vol. 1), Brill, Leiden 1988, ISBN 9004081658
- Agha, Sheikh and State - Politics and Society of Kurdistan (German translation of the dissertation from 1978, with revisions), Edition Parabolis, Berlin 1989, ISBN 3884022598
Editorships
- with Stefano Allievi: Producing Islamic knowledge: transmission and dissemination in Western Europe. Routledge, Abingdon et al. 2010, ISBN 978-0-415-35592-6 .
- with Julia Day Howell: Sufism and the 'modern' in Islam. Tauris, London et al. 2007, ISBN 978-1-85043-854-0 .
